Adélia Sabatini's *Dior Catwalk*, published by Éditions La Martinière, isn't just a book; it's a meticulously curated immersion into the breathtaking history of Dior's runway presentations. This first-ever anthology of Dior designs, presented through over 180 catwalk photographs, acts as a visual testament to the house's enduring legacy, showcasing its evolution from the New Look's revolutionary silhouette to the contemporary interpretations championed by its successive creative directors. The immediate impact of opening *Dior Catwalk* is visual. The carefully selected photographs, spanning decades of fashion shows, offer a chronological journey through the house's stylistic transformations. From the meticulously crafted gowns of Christian Dior himself, characterized by their cinched waists, full skirts, and opulent fabrics, to the more modern, streamlined aesthetics of subsequent designers like Yves Saint Laurent, Marc Bohan, Gianfranco Ferré, John Galliano, Raf Simons, and Maria Grazia Chiuri, the book captures the evolution of haute couture itself. Each photograph is not merely a record of a garment; it's a snapshot of a specific moment in time, reflecting the social, cultural, and artistic climate of its era.

The book's strength lies in its ability to contextualize these images. While the visual feast is undeniable, Sabatini's curation goes beyond mere aesthetics. The selection of photographs isn't random; it’s thoughtfully chosen to illustrate key moments in Dior's history, highlighting pivotal collections, groundbreaking designs, and the evolution of the house's signature style. The reader isn't simply presented with a series of pretty pictures; they are guided through a narrative arc, witnessing the development of Dior's identity, its experimentation with different silhouettes and aesthetics, and its constant adaptation to changing trends while maintaining its core identity.
